West Point was not able to break out of their rough patch on Tuesday as the team picked up their seventh straight defeat. They lost 8-0 to the Lafayette Commodores. While losing is never fun, West Point can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Mississippi soccer rankings (they are ranked 148th, while Lafayette are ranked 30th).
West Point's loss dropped their record down to 1-9. As for Lafayette, they have been performing incredibly well recently as they've won six of their last seven contests. That's provided a massive bump to their 8-4-1 record this season.
We've got plenty of inter-district action coming up soon. West Point will square off against rival New Hope at 7:00 p.m. on Thursday. Meanwhile, Lafayette is set to face off against their familiar foe Columbus at 6:45 p.m. on Thursday.
